Abstract :
The augmentation of transistor technologies with resonant tunnelling diodes (RTDs) has demonstrated improved circuit performance and it has been claimed that it could be the way to extend lifetime of current technologies. Thus the research on circuit topologies using RTDs and transistors is of critical importance for these emergent technologies. In particular, threshold logic gates (TGs) and multi threshold gates (MTTGs) have been efficiently implemented. In this paper we propose a novel circuit topology to implement MTTGs which exhibits advantages in terms of speed and power consumption with respect to the previously reported circuit. A comparison between both topologies is carried out for a useful logic block: a gate which simultaneously implements the EXOR and the NAND functions.
